C# 数据类型在 C# 中,变量分为以下几种类型:值类型(Value types)引用类型(Reference types)指针类型(Pointer types)区别:值类型直接存储其值。引用类型存储对值的引用。其本质是Value与Reference的区别,两种类型在内存中的存储方式有显著区别。不同的存储对象值…
2019-11-20 276
属性public 类字段,就相当于c#里面暴露给外面的属性,类似nodejs的 module.exports但是属性又不同于普通的字段,属性只是外部包装字段 没有自己的任何含量 类似退换后的方法。 还是需要内部字段来设置。private 类字段,就相当于类内部使用的字段。其实可以把属性看做私…
2019-11-19 287
C#中类的方法(构造方法)一、类中的构造方法;语法:与类名相同,不能有返还值,不能加void。使用快捷键:ct(双击tab)自动为当前的类添加不带参数的默认构造函数。作用:对类进行实例化对象的操作实质就是调用当前类的构造方法;还可以使用带参数的构造方法完成对类的属性的…
2019-11-19 280
创建类的对象时,会自动生成调用一个默认的无参构造函数给初始化对象赋初值,也可以通过有参构造函数实现,如下面的代码:namespace test{ class Program { static void Main(string[] args) { Person p = new Person("hehe");…
2019-11-19 260
C# List中Find的用法在决定使用List<T>还是使用ArrayList类时,记住List<T>在大多数情况下执行的更好并且是类型安全的。List.Find方法:搜索与制定谓词所定义的条件相匹配的元素,并返回整个List中的第一个匹配元素。public T Find(Predicate<T> match…
2019-11-19 356